2. Hiking-
If you want your kids to develop a love for the natural outdoors, hiking can be a great alternative. Hiking allows kids to appreciate natural beauty as well as develop physical stamina and endurance. You can also teach them things like using a compass, setting up a tent, learning how to cook with basic essentials, and a whole lot of other positive things. 3. Kayaking-
In the last few years, many families have taken to kayaking as a fun and healthy outdoor leisure activity. You can go for this, especially if you live in and around natural water bodies. However, knowing how to swim should be an important precursor to going kayaking. This can also be made more fun by combining it with some sport fishing and swimming in the lake.
4. Cycling-
The health benefits of cycling have been known to us for the longest time. However, what we did not know is how cycling is a great way for the entire family to bond together. With global warming and climate change being a harsh reality of our times, maybe cycling can encourage our kids to look for healthier and more eco-friendly alternatives to transportation.
5. Camping-
We have already mentioned that parents can teach their kids a lot about being self-sufficient in external conditions when hiking. Well, camping can also be a great way to spend some quality time. There are so many great campsites where families can spend the weekend, getting in touch with natural surroundings. Campfires, marshmallows, etc. make for great family time.
